Hosted by Gurthro Steenkamp , this podcast dives into performance, mindset, and resilience. With insights from athletes, coaches, and leaders, we explore the lessons rugby teaches about success—both on and off the field.
Perfect for rugby enthusiasts, coaches, and anyone seeking inspiration to elevate their game and life.

From a 53m Lions series-winner in 2009 to repeating the fairytale in 2021, Morne Steyn breaks down how composure is trained, not born. Contact & collision specialist Richie Gray shares why the best coaches “coach people, not players,” and how to create accurate aggression—the controlled edge that wins tackles and breakdowns. We dig into earning trust in superstar environments, keeping messages simple under fatigue, individualizing coaching inside a team, Fiji’s shared-vision culture, and drill-based training that sharpens technique while lowering injury risk.
